Non Hodgkins Lymphoma of Head and Neck: A Clinicopathological Review of 15 Cases in a Tertiary Care Centre

Shubhi Tyagi | M. D Prakash


Abstract: 4- 15 % non hodgkins lymphoma patients constitute head and neck extra nodal Non Hodkins Lymphoma. . This was a retrospective study performed to characterise the various sites, clinical manifestations and histopathological features present in non hodgkins lymphoma of head and neck. Out of 15 cases studies 11 were males and 4 females. the mean age was 51.9 years. Most common site of presentation was the waldeyer ring with most common clinical manifestation as a neck mass. most common histopathological subtype was DLBCL.
